Description of issue
nimi-bot currently consists of 5 VMs (1 Jenkins, 4 Agents) running on a decade old Dell server. It looks like the main bottle neck is the HDD which slows down significantly the tests every time the virtual environments need to be recreated.
Specs:
- Dell PowerEdge T410
- 2.4 GHz 2x6 CPU Xeon E5-2440
- 24 GB memory
- 1x 1GB network
- 8 TB storage (~550 GB provisioned)
- SW
- Hypervisor - ESXi 6.7 standard
- OS in VMs - Windows 10 1909
